In this role, you’re expected to:

The AVP, Client Service Manager role, responsible for providing clients with resolutions and support in coordination with Client Delivery department. The overall objective of this role is to address external customer issues and provide ongoing customer service support pertaining to Custody and Transaction Management perspectives (covering Pre-Settlements, Settlements, Cash, and Forex).

Responsibilities:

Manage a portfolio of high-profile clients, ensuring queries are acknowledged, investigated and resolved timely and professionally and in line with departmental standards

Provide coaching and support to team and serve a point of contact for escalations

  • Develop and maintain client portfolio through regular calls and face to face interaction, as needed
  • Inform clients about problems (system failures, market issues) and provide regular resolution updates
  • Advise on and advocate the implementation of process improvement and reengineering to improve client experience
  • Maintain knowledge of new market and regulatory requirements affecting client portfolio/base
  • Escalate customer feedback, processing delays and errors appropriately
  • Conduct necessary analyses to resolve problems, liaising with internal teams on escalation, as necessary
  • Complete tasks such as reviews, audit preparation, capacity planning, reporting and maintain control environment
  • Participate in and advise on inquiry-volume reduction, client experience initiatives and cross-departmental initiatives
  •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, demonstrating particular consideration for the firm's reputation and safeguarding Citigroup, its clients and assets,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ct and business practices, and escalating, managing and reporting control issues with transparency.

Qualifications:

  • 3-5 years of Client Service/Custody experience
  • Relevant Transaction Management/Asset Servicing/Securities Lending experience (business/financial environment) preferred
  • Demonstrated project management and organizational skills to prioritize multiple tasks
  • Proven self-reliance and accountability and ability to manage risk
  • Consistently demonstrate clear and concise written and verbal communication with ability to influence stakeholders
  • Proven investigative and analytical skills
  • Consistently deliver high-quality customer service with focus on building client relationships and achieving quality results

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ree/University degree or equivalent experience

Citigroup Inc. or Citi is an American multinational investment bank and financial services company based in New York City. The company was formed in 1998 by the merger of Citicorp, the bank holding company for Citibank, and Travelers; Travelers was spun off from the company in 2002.
